Ojai Listening Session Beautiful

Last Thursday, Linda O'Toole and I had the great gift of being with 11 wonderful young people from the Ojai Valley Youth Foundation.  What was supposed to be 8 students, grew to 11 and it was a profoundly beautiful experience.

The students came from four different schools and while they did not know each other in the beginning, you would have thought they had known each other for years at the end.  It was very gratifying to hear their answers and to see their concepts come to life in their paintings.  They all supported each other tremendously and the paintings showed their deep desire to help create change in education.

Here is a look at their paintings. Each one tells a story about the learning experience that each group would love to create. More on that later:
